Why Los Angeles Conditions Change the Rules

Los Angeles mixes hot, dry summers with mild, wetter winters. Coastal neighborhoods get marine layer and salt in the air. Inland valleys see higher heat and UV exposure.

Durability comes down to how your coating handles:

  • Intense sun
  • Salt-laden air
  • Moisture from rain, condensation, or small leaks

Systems that allow incidental moisture to move outward and evaporate tend to avoid blistering and widespread peeling on masonry. Dense-film coatings can still perform well—but only if the wall assembly stays dry and is meticulously detailed.

How Limewash Works—and Why It Lasts on Masonry

Limewash is a mineral coating made from slaked lime and natural pigments. On stucco, brick, and stone, it doesn’t just sit on the surface—it chemically reacts with carbon dioxide to form a rock-like matrix that bonds into the pores of the masonry.

Key advantages in LA:

  • Mineral-to-mineral bond remains stable under intense sun
  • Highly breathable: lets trapped moisture escape, preventing pressure buildup
  • Ages gracefully through patina—not catastrophic peeling
  • Exterior touch-ups blend seamlessly
  • Interior application (over mineral primer on drywall) creates a premium, low-glare, textured finish ideal for design-focused spaces and photo studios

How Regular Acrylic/Latex Paint Performs

Acrylic and latex paints form a continuous, flexible film that offers:

  • Uniform color and predictable sheen
  • Broad compatibility across substrates

Best suited for:
Wood siding, trim, factory-sealed boards, and metals—where a protective film is essential.

On masonry:
The same film can be durable if the wall stays dry and is well-detailed. But if moisture enters (via cracks, failed flashings, or capillary action), drying through a dense film is slow—leading to bubbling, peeling, or adhesion loss.

Good detailing and proactive maintenance keep acrylic systems in the safe zone. Without them, failure can be sudden and costly.

Expected Service Life You Can Plan Around

  • Exterior acrylic systems in California typically last 5–10 years, depending on location:
  • Shorter near the coast (due to salt and humidity)
  • Longer inland with top-tier products and perfect prep
  • Mineral systems on compatible masonry often go significantly longer between major refreshes—because they weather by patina, not film failure

Note: Prep quality, exposure, and building detailing affect longevity far more than brand names.

Substrate-by-Substrate Verdicts for LA

Stucco and Brick Exteriors

Best for longevity (especially near the coast): Limewash or mineral paint.

  • Integrates with the wall
  • Handles sun and moisture cycles well
  • Supports drying after fog or rain

If you prefer a painted look: Choose mineral-based paints—not low-permeance acrylic films.

Previously Painted Masonry

  • Exterior: If the existing coating is sound and you want uniform color, a premium acrylic system (with proper prep) can work. Switching to limewash requires careful assessment of adhesion, moisture behavior, and detailing.
  • Interior: Use a mineral undercoat to create a compatible base, then apply limewash for an authentic finish.

Interior Drywall

  • Limewash: Ideal for low-glare, high-character spaces (e.g., studios, lobbies, designer homes).
  • Acrylic: Better for high-traffic or high-moisture areas needing washability, precise sheen control, or scrub resistance.

Wood and Metals

Stick with high-quality acrylics or specialty coatings.
Limewash isn’t designed for long-term performance on bare wood or metal without complex, multi-layer systems. Film-forming coatings better handle movement, weather exposure, and corrosion protection.

Which LA Microclimate Are You In?

Coastal Zone (Santa Monica, Venice, South Bay)

Challenges: Salt, persistent marine layer, slow drying
Best picks:

  • Mineral coatings on masonry (for breathability and color stability)
  • Marine-grade acrylics on trim and metals

Inland Valleys (Studio City, Sherman Oaks, Pasadena, SGV)

Challenges: High UV, intense heat, sharp afternoon sun
Best picks:

  • Mineral systems for colorfastness and graceful aging on masonry
  • Premium acrylics—if assemblies are stable and shaded details reduce thermal stress

Hills and Canyons

Challenges: Wind exposure, temperature swings, microclimates
Best approach: Prioritize crack management and flashing details first—then choose coating type based on actual wall assemblies in each zone.

Maintenance and the Real Cost of Durability

  • Limewash on masonry: Requires light, periodic refresh—not full strip-and-repaint.
    → Plan annual post-rain inspections, quick flashing fixes, gentle washing, and small touch-ups that blend naturally.
  • Acrylic systems: Benefit from regular cleaning, joint maintenance, and spot priming to prevent film failure.

In LA, the most expensive event is a wholesale repaint after widespread peeling. A system that helps walls dry—and avoids that failure—often wins on total cost of ownership.

When Acrylic Clearly Wins

  • Wood siding
  • Factory-finished boards (to preserve warranties)
  • Handrails, doors, and metal elements
  • Spaces requiring scrub resistance or exact sheen control (e.g., kitchens, bathrooms, commercial lobbies)

When Limewash Clearly Wins

  • Historic or highly porous masonry
  • Coastal stucco/brick exposed to marine moisture
  • Interiors where an ultra-matte, handcrafted finish supports brand identity or design vision

A Practical Decision Checklist for LA Property Owners

  1. Identify each substrate by area: stucco, brick, block, drywall, wood, metal
  2. Map your microclimate: marine influence vs. inland heat/UV
  3. Choose your maintenance style: light touch-ups with graceful aging vs. full repaint cycles
  4. Verify product legitimacy: Use only reputable brands active in LA; review current technical data sheets
  5. Test before you commit: Apply samples on your actual walls, in your real lighting

Bottom Line

On LA masonry, a correctly specified and professionally applied limewash or mineral system typically provides the most resilient, low-risk path to long service life—because it integrates with the wall, supports drying, and ages by patina.

On wood, metals, and most trim, a premium acrylic system remains the smart, durable choice.

The right answer isn’t a slogan—it’s a site-specific specification.
